Description
This is a combined synopsis/solicitation for commercial services prepared in accordance with RFO Part 12. This announcement constitutes the only solicitation. Offers are being requested, and a separate written solicitation will not be issued.
Solicitation number N3220526R0002 is issued as a request for proposal (RFP) for diving services to provide hull cleaning, hull inspection, incidental repairs, cofferdam services, and other related ship husbandry on the underwater portion of MSC Government Owned, Government Operated (GOGO) Vessels. Services will be performed worldwide.
This acquisition is not set aside for small business concerns. This solicitation incorporates provisions and clauses by reference. The full text of provisions and clauses may be accessed electronically at https://www.acquisition.gov/far-overhaul.
This solicitation does not have a Defense Priorities and Allocation System (DPAS) rating.
See attached SF 1449 for a list of all details of the supplies and/or services required and a list of all solicitation provisions and contract clauses that apply to the acquisition.
Responses to the solicitation are due 5:00 PM Eastern Time on 17 July 2026. Proposal may be e-mailed to Mr. Timothy Lewis, timothy.lewis60.civ@us.navy.mil, and Mrs. Shelby Beach, shelby.m.beach.civ@us.navy.mil. To be considered timely, an e-mail proposal must be received in its entirety in the designated e-mail inbox by the due date and time for proposal submission. Reference the solicitation number on your proposal. E-mail proposals shall be in the format specified within the solicitation. No other method of submission is acceptable.
The anticipated award date is 10 August 2026.
One or more of the items under this acquisition is subject to the World Trade Organization Government Procurement Agreement and Free Trade Agreements.
All responsible sources may submit a proposal, which shall be considered by the agency.
